When useAzureMonitor() is called multiple times, old AutoCollectExceptions and AutoCollectLogs instances were silently overwritten without cleanup, causing process event listener accumulation and retaining old LogApi instances (and their downstream spans/connection metadata) in memory.

This adds shutdown of previous instances before re-initialization and a test verifying listeners do not accumulate.

Also fix flaky test infrastructure for testing CI.

Fixes: #1415
